Advances in Botanical Research, Volume 96, highlights new advances in the field, with this new volume presenting interesting chapters on the Structure and supramolecular architecture of chloroplast ATP synthase, Chloroplast ATP Synthase from Green Microalgae, Subunit movements in H-ATPases from chloroplasts detected by single molecule FRET, Regulation and control of the chloroplast ATP synthase: mechanisms and impact on maintaining efficient photosynthesis and photoprotection, Regulation machineries of ATP synthase from phototroph, How do we understand the formation of delta-pH in photosynthesis?, Regulation of photosynthesis by cyclic electron transport around photosystem, and the Biogenesis regulation of chloroplast ATP synthase.
